Product Introduction

Definition
A petroleum perforating gun is a core tool in oil and gas well completion operations. It uses directional blasting technology to create channels in casing and formations, enabling efficient flow of hydrocarbons from reservoirs to wellbores.

Structural Components

1. Gun Body

– Constructed from high-strength alloy steel to withstand downhole high-temperature and high-pressure environments.

– Houses components such as perforating charges and detonating cords.

2. Perforating Charges

– Utilize shaped charges to generate high-velocity metal jets upon explosion, penetrating casing and rock.

– Types include deep penetration charges, large diameter charges, and composite charges, tailored for different formation requirements.

3. Detonation System

– Triggered by detonating cords or electric detonators to ensure synchronous ignition of multiple charges.

– Some models feature smart ignition devices for precise timing control.

4. Centralizers and Seals

– Centralizers stabilize the gun’s position to avoid collisions with casing.

– Sealing structures prevent well fluid ingress, ensuring reliable blasting.

Working Principle

1. Downhole Positioning: The perforating gun is delivered to the target interval via cables or tubing.

2. Ignition Control: Surface or downhole tools trigger the detonation system, igniting charges sequentially.

3. Rock Penetration: Shaped charge jets (speed >8,000 m/s) penetrate casing, cement sheath, and formations, forming 10–20 mm diameter holes with depths of 0.5–2 meters.

4. Flow Path Creation: Channels connect the wellbore to reservoirs, establishing fluid seepage routes.

Application Scenarios

– Conventional Reservoirs (sandstone, carbonate): Optimize production.

– Unconventional Reservoirs (shale, tight gas): Enhance fracturing effectiveness.

– Horizontal/High-Deviation Wells: Directional perforation for zonal stimulation.

– Mature Well Reactivation: Tap remaining oil through recompletion.

Technical Advantages

1. Efficient Rock Penetration: High-velocity jets ensure deep and clean holes.

2. Precision Control: Adjustable perforation density (shots per meter) and phase angles (90°, 120°, 180°).

3. Reliability: Impact-resistant, high-temperature (≤180°C), and corrosion-resistant designs.

4. Environmental Friendliness: Reduce wellbore contamination and operational costs.
